Web19 jul. 2024 · Key Steps: Use a cream degreaser to remove tough build-ups of grease with the best results. For small areas, natural degreasers can be used. Try a mix of baking soda and water. Avoid strong degreasers for cleaning wooden surfaces. Instead try white spirit. Always test your cleaning product on a hidden area first and follow the instructions on ...

WebTo remove greasy stains from your walls, use an old cleaning favourite: white vinegar. Mix one cup of white vinegar into a bucket of warm water, and use a soft sponge to tackle stubborn stains. You can also try using washing-up liquid and warm water.

Web31 aug. 2024 · Simply wipe down all your walls with the warm soapy water. Then, go back over the walls with clean warm water to rise off the soapy reside. Allow your walls to dry 100%, usually a couple of hours (or speed it up with a fan), then sand your walls with a pole sander as mentioned above, wipe off the dust and you’re ready to paint. Web8 mrt. 2024 · Spray bottle. Clean cloth. Microfiber cloth. In the spray bottle, combine 1 part baking soda, 2 parts warm water, and the juice of 1 lemon. Mix them together thoroughly. Spray onto the kitchen cabinets and leave for 5 minutes to remove grease. Gently scrub the solution away with a soft sponge damp with clean water.
